Elon Musk’s Vision for Grok 3.5: Revolutionizing AI and Human Knowledge

In a recent tweet, tech entrepreneur Elon Musk shared groundbreaking thoughts on the future of artificial intelligence and its potential to transform how we process and understand human knowledge. Musk announced plans to utilize Grok 3.5, an advanced AI model that he suggested might be more aptly named Grok 4 due to its sophisticated reasoning capabilities. His vision involves rewriting the entire corpus of human knowledge, addressing inaccuracies, and supplementing gaps in information. This initiative aims to create a more reliable and powerful foundation model to enhance AI performance.

The Process of Rewriting Human Knowledge

Musk outlined a systematic approach to achieving this ambitious goal. The first step involves assessing the existing corpus of human knowledge, identifying inaccuracies, and pinpointing areas lacking sufficient information. By using advanced reasoning capabilities, Grok 3.5 will analyze this corpus to refine its content systematically.

Once the initial assessment is complete, the next phase entails retraining the model on the newly curated data. This retraining will ensure that Grok 3.5 can not only recognize and correct previous errors but also incorporate new findings, making it a dynamic and continually evolving repository of knowledge.

Ethics in AI Development

Another challenge is the ethical implications of creating an AI that rewrites human knowledge. Who gets to decide what information is added or removed? How do we ensure that the model doesn’t reflect the biases of its creators? These are important questions that need to be addressed as we move forward with projects like Grok. Transparency in the development process and a diverse team of contributors can help mitigate some of these concerns.
